Skip to main content

Qu'est-ce qu'un registre de quart?

Comme appliqué aux circuits numériques, un registre de décalage est une série de tongs basés sur la synchronisation séquentielle d'horloge.Les tongs facilitent les données mobiles de l'entrée à la sortie à l'aide de la logique séquentielle.Une horloge, sous la forme d'une onde répétitive dans un motif carré, est utilisée pour synchroniser la façon dont les données se déplacent à travers des registres de décalage, créant un court retard dans la transmission d'un signal numérique.Le plus souvent, les registres de décalage des longueurs variables sont utilisés pour convertir les données parallèles en série, mais peuvent également être utilisés pour le flux de données dans les microprocesseurs ou pour les données analogiques secrètes en numériques et vice versa.

Les registres de décalage sont des circuits à grande vitesse.Principalement, un registre de décalage déplace des bits de données à gauche ou à droite le long d'un circuit, en fonction de la structure spécifique des circuits.Dans sa forme la plus simple, un registre de changement de vitesse prend des données au premier stade et déplace des bits à une étape à gauche ou à droite car l'horloge signale la nécessité d'une avance de données.Les registres sont identifiés par le nombre de créneaux de stockage temporaires disponibles après chaque étape entre l'entrée et la sortie.Les emplacements de stockage temporaires permettent à un registre de décalage de retarder les signaux de données jusqu'à ce que les signaux d'horloge appropriés progressent.Un registre 8 bits, par exemple, a huit étapes et donc huit emplacements de stockage temporaires pour les bits dans une chaîne de données.

Structurellement, il existe cinq types de base de registres de décalage.Les registres de décalage parallèles / parallèles de série de séries / sérial et parallèles facilitent l'entrée et la sortie des données sous forme de série ou de forme parallèle respectivement, sans conversions requises.Parallèle-in / Serial-Out fait référence aux registres de décalage qui traitent les entrées de transmission de données parallèles et convertissent ces transmissions en sortie sous forme de série.Les registres de décalage en série-in / parallèle sont presque identiques à parallèle-in / sérial-out, à l'exception des données d'entrée sous forme de série convertie en sortie de forme parallèle.

Un compteur d'anneau est un type de structure de registre de décalage qui présente des modèles de données de recirculation ou de répétition.Lorsqu'un registre de décalage termine le traitement d'une chaîne de données et renforce la dernière étape à l'étape d'entrée de données initiale, un modèle circulaire en résulte.Les compteurs d'anneaux sont utilisés lorsqu'une fonction spécifique est requise sur un motif de répétition de définition.Par exemple, un affichage LED définie pour répéter les écrans choisis peut utiliser une structure de compteur d'anneau pour le registre de décalage afin que la sortie se répète à une impulsion d'horloge prédéterminée.mémoire d'ordinateur.L'utilisation des registres de décalage a remplacé les lignes de retard de mercure, accélérant le traitement des données et permettant des composants informatiques plus petits et des périphériques.Aujourd'hui, les registres de changement de vitesse en tant que mémoire d'ordinateur primaire sont considérés comme désuets.Les cartes de circuits imprimées, cependant, comportent toujours des registres de décalage pour réduire la quantité de câblage nécessaire, en particulier dans les pilotes d'affichage, les convertisseurs numériques à analogiques et la mémoire de données série.